+ How long is the steel bar that goes across the door?
The standard length is 44". Generally, we like to see 4" of bar on both sides of the door so the standard size fits perfect on most 36" doors. Different lengths can be ordered for a small fee. Please contact Mike Nydam at 408-515-5878 for more information.
+ How do I install the EZ-Install Clp?
First of all, the ez-install clip is an option. You can purchase them as an option with the HPL-1. It is mounted across from the door handle and provides a simple alignment bracket to hold the CinchLock while you tighten the claw on the door handle.
+ Does the Cinchlock CL work on outward opening doors that are on the outside of buildings?
Typically weather stripping mounted on the bottom of outer doors is designed to keep water and moisture out of the building. It also interferes with the Cinchlock CL sliding easily under these outer doors. If this is the case at your location, the HPL-1 provides an excellent alternative.
+ What's the main difference between the HPL-1 and HPL-2?
The HPL-1 has only one adjustable clamp for securing a door handle or panic bar. The HPL-2 uses the same steel bar but has 2 adjustable clamps for securing a set of double doors such as those typically found in gymnasiums.
